In this study, we analyzed 340 whole genomes of SARS-CoV-2, which were sampled between April and November 2020 in 33 cities Rio Grande do Sul, South Brazil. We demonstrated the circulation two novel emergent lineages, VUI-NP13L VUI-NP13L-like, five major lineages that had already been assigned (B.1.1.33, B.1.1.28, P.2, B.1.91, B.1.195). P.2 a massive spread October 2020. Constant consistent genomic surveillance is crucial to identify newly emerging SARS-CoV-2 Brazil guide decision making...
Genomic surveillance of SARS-CoV-2 is paramount for understanding viral dynamics, contributing to disease control. This study analyzed genomic diversity in Rio Grande do Sul (RS), Brazil, including the first reported case each Regional Health Coordination and cases from three epidemic peaks. Ninety genomes RS were sequenced through comparison with datasets available GISAID phylogenetic inference mutation analysis. Among cases, we found following lineages: B.1 (33.3%), B.1.1.28 (26.7%), B.1.1...

ABSTRACT Enterococci are commensal gut microbes of most land animals. They diversified over hundreds millions years adapting to evolving hosts and host diets. Of 60 known enterococcal species, Enterococcus faecalis E. faecium uniquely emerged in the antibiotic era among leading causes multidrug resistant hospital-associated infection. The basis for association particular species with a is largely unknown. To begin deciphering traits that drive association, assess pool -adapted genes from...

The fidelity of the genomes is defended by mechanism known as Clustered Regularly Interspaced Short Palindromic Repeats (CRISPR) systems. Three Type II CRISPR systems (CRISPR1- cas, CRISPR2 and CRISPR3-cas) have been identified in enterococci isolates from clinical environmental samples. aim this study was to observe distribution CRISPR1-cas, CRISPR3-cas non-clinical strains Enterococcus faecalis faecium food fecal samples, including wild marine animals. presence CRISPRs evaluated PCR 120...

ABSTRACT: Enterococci have been used as sentinel organisms for monitoring antimicrobial resistance in food, humans, and other animals. In this sense, the present study evaluated susceptibility profile presence of genes associated with to erythromycin (msrC ermB) tetracycline [tet(M) and/or tet(L)] enterococci isolated from raw sheep’s milk cheeses (colonial, feta-, pecorino-type) South region Brazil. A total 156 were (n=80) cheese (n=76) samples, identified by MALDI-TOF. Enterococcus...
